Simplifying 8b2 + 22b + -10 = 6b Reorder the terms: -10 + 22b + 8b2 = 6b Solving -10 + 22b + 8b2 = 6b Solving for variable 'b'. Reorder the terms: -10 + 22b + -6b + 8b2 = 6b + -6b Combine like terms: 22b + -6b = 16b -10 + 16b + 8b2 = 6b + -6b Combine like terms: 6b + -6b = 0 -10 + 16b + 8b2 = 0 Factor out the Greatest Common Factor (GCF), '2'. 2(-5 + 8b + 4b2) = 0 Factor a trinomial. 2((-5 + -2b)(1 + -2b)) = 0 Ignore the factor 2.Subproblem 1
Set the factor '(-5 + -2b)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ying -5 + -2b = 0 Solving -5 + -2b = 0 Move all terms containing b to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'5' to each side of the equation. -5 + 5 + -2b = 0 + 5 Combine like terms: -5 + 5 = 0 0 + -2b = 0 + 5 -2b = 0 + 5 Combine like terms: 0 + 5 = 5 -2b = 5 Divide each side by '-2'. b = -2.5 Simplifying b = -2.5Subproblem 2
Set the factor '(1 + -2b)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 1 + -2b = 0 Solving 1 + -2b = 0 Move all terms containing b to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1' to each side of the equation. 1 + -1 + -2b =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 1 + -1 = 0 0 + -2b = 0 + -1 -2b =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 0 + -1 = -1 -2b = -1 Divide each side by '-2'. b = 0.5 Simplifying b = 0.5Solution
b = {-2.5, 0.5}
